Example of Matching Landing Page and Blog Design
I just finished a landing page and WordPress blog theme design that was so much fun to work on! Good friends of mine are going to be traveling on an evangelistic team beginning this fall, and they will be holding youth rallies on most weekends in churches all around the country. They wanted a fun site where kids who’ve attended or are going to attend theses Coffee Wars rallies can log look at pictures and video from the week, get updates, have access to more Christian resources, and stay in touch. It’s also designed to help out churches or individuals planning to attend a rally by offering necessary information and downloads to prepare for the event. Because they won’t be officially starting until the fall, there is a lot of information, pictures, pages, and video that will continue to be added as time goes on.
I designed the landing page using Sitegrinder, a Photoshop plugin. The elements of the blog theme were also designed in Photoshop and then completed through Artisteer. There are still a few plugins that need to be uploading, but for the most part the setup and design are complete. I will be creating a personalized Twitter background to match the site as well as an image to use for the site’s facebook page as well.
